SSL(Secure Sockets Layer)证书是一种数字证书,用于在Web服务器和浏览器之间建立安全的加密连接。SSL证书包含公钥和相关的身份信息,并由受信任的第三方机构(称为证书颁发机构,CA)签名。通过SSL证书,可以确保数据在传输过程中不被窃取或篡改。
获取SSL证书通常需要通过以下步骤:
以下是一个使用Let's Encrypt获取SSL证书的示例(适用于Nginx服务器):
# 安装Certbot
sudo apt-get update
sudo apt-get install certbot python3-certbot-nginx
# 获取并安装SSL证书
sudo certbot --nginx -d example.com -d www.example.com
# 验证安装
sudo certbot renew --dry-run
sudo certbot renew
通过以上步骤和方法,可以成功获取并安装SSL证书,确保网站的安全性和可信度。
开箱吧腾讯云
TC-Day
TC-Day
云+社区沙龙online第5期[架构演进]
第五期Techo TVP开发者峰会
云+社区技术沙龙[第6期]
腾讯云培训认证中心开放日
云+社区沙龙online [技术应变力]
领取专属 10元无门槛券
手把手带您无忧上云